Give a character sketch of the narrator in "the portrait of a lady" by khushwant singh

The narrator, Khushwant Singh, comes across as rather perceptive in his observations on his grandmother. Having been entirely brought up under her care, Singh, displays a genteel sensitivity towards his grandmother, who he thought was 'eternally old' and 'ancient'. He presents a keen observation of his grandmother, and her gradual transformation from a happy and active woman of the world to a recluse--a change brought about by the changing times and the world around her.
